Can I Deduct Health Insurance Premiums Deducted From My Paycheck?

Can I Deduct Health Insurance Premiums Deducted From My Paycheck? No, you are not allowed to deduct pre-tax premiums for health insurance on your tax return. You are already receiving the tax benefit by paying the premiums with your pre-taxed earnings. You can only deduct the medical expenses paid for with after-tax earnings. Are health

Does Germany Pay For Immigrant Health Insurance?

Does Germany Pay For Immigrant Health Insurance? Asylum seekers and refugees in Germany are not covered under the statutory health insurance scheme. However, international laws and certain EU directives obligate the German health care system to provide a set of basic medical services to asylum seekers and refugees when needed. Does German Health Care Need A Registration With Family Doctor?

Does German Health Care Need A Registration With Family Doctor? In Germany, patients have the right to choose their doctors, such as general practitioners, pediatricians, and gynecologists. Does Any International Health Insurance Cover Preexisitng Condtions?

Does Any International Health Insurance Cover Preexisitng Condtions? Some providers will grant coverage for pre-existing conditions after a lesser period. Often, if you have “prior creditable coverage”, meaning another insurance plan in place at the time you apply for your new international plan, coverage for pre-existing conditions may be granted in even less time. Does Health Insurance Ask For Taxable Income?

Does Health Insurance Ask For Taxable Income? The Heath Insurance Marketplace uses an income figure called Modified Adjusted Gross Income (MAGI) to determine the programs and savings you qualify for.
